86-246.  Automatic dialing-announcing device; certain use prohibited.
A person shall not use an automatic dialing-announcing device in such a way that two or more telephone lines of a business with a multiline telephone system are engaged simultaneously.
Source 
 -  Laws 1993, LB 305, § 10; 
-  R.S.1943, (1999), § 86-1210; 
- Laws 2002, LB 1105, § 108.
